About the role

Reporting to: Head of Department / SLT Line Manager An opportunity has arisen to join our outstanding English team, in our forward thinking and aspirational school based in Warwickshire’s beautiful, medieval market town of Henley-in-Arden. You’ll be joining our passionate and high performing department which nurtures and develops our students’ knowledge in English. Our department's results are significantly above national averages this year, including over 83% 9-5 pass rate last year. We are looking for a passionate teacher to join us to continue this transformative success for our students. Our English department also nurtures a love of subject through a range of innovative teaching techniques and activities, including a range of immersive experiences and trips to engage our learners. Main Purpose of the Role: - Be accountable and responsible for the learning and progress of pupils in assigned classes ensuring excellence for and from all Work with the Head of English and wider team to further develop our strong Teaching and Learning practice in the department Work proactively and effectively in collaboration and partnership with learners, parents/carers, governors, other staff and external agencies in the best interests of pupils Act within the statutory frameworks, which set out professional duties and responsibilities and in line with the duties outlined in accordance with school policies, the current School Teachers Pay and Conditions Document and Teacher Standards (2012) Responsible for promoting and safeguarding the welfare of children and young people within the school. We are looking forward to receiving applications from teachers who are looking for an exciting new challenge to impact the lives of our students. You’ll be joining our ever-improving school, which year on year ensures all our students are prepared for the next step in their education. We promise to offer you both a stimulating and highly rewarding experience in return for your motivational skills and good practice. Opportunities don’t arise very often to work in a vibrant school like Henley-in-Arden and we are delighted to be offering the chance for someone to join the team. In return we can offer you: A positive and innovative learning culture supported by students, staff, parents and governors A collaborative and supportive attitude amongst staff which promotes a sense of teamwork and unity A Senior Leadership team who is committed to promoting the best environment and outcomes for staff and students Cycle to Work scheme The potential to collaborate and work with other staff in our Multi-Academy Trust. Please see our ‘Application Pack’ for further information, Job Description and Person Specification. We are proud to be part of the Arden Multi-Academy trust, partnered with three other schools in the local area including Arden Academy in Knowle. This support mechanism ensures that leaders collaborate and innovate together
